42 connections·40 entities in this video→Yella Beezy's Capital Murder Indictment and Bond
- 🎤 Rapper Yella Beezy, born Markies Conway, was indicted for capital murder on March 18th, stemming from the 2020 killing of fellow rapper MO3.
- 💰 Initially facing a $2 million bail, his bond was reduced to $750,000 by Judge Gracie Lewis, allowing his release under strict house arrest and electronic monitoring.
- ⚠️ The judge cited the severity of the offense and concerns about the defendant's seriousness regarding the allegations as reasons for the strict conditions.
Bond Modification Request Denied
- ⚽ Yella Beezy's defense attorney filed a motion requesting permission for him to temporarily leave home confinement to attend his son's football games.
- ⚖️ The judge denied this request, upholding the home confinement condition pending the outcome of his trial.
- 🎶 Despite restrictions, Yella Beezy recently returned to social media to promote his new song, "In My Head."
Allegations and Key Players in the Murder-for-Hire Case
- 🎯 Prosecutors allege Yella Beezy hired the gunman, Kewon White, to carry out the hit on MO3, rather than firing the shots himself.
- 🔫 Kewon White is identified as the alleged shooter, with Devon Maurice Brown as an alleged accomplice; both were indicted years ago.
- ⛓️ Kewon White is currently serving a 9-year federal sentence for gun charges, while Devon Brown remains in Dallas County Jail.
Potential Motive and Case Escalation
- 💥 Rumors suggest the beef between MO3 and Yella Beezy began in 2018 after the shooting death of MO3's friend, Roy Lee, who had allegedly questioned Yella Beezy's claim on a Dallas neighborhood.
- 🔄 This led to a cycle of retaliatory shootings and diss tracks between the artists, culminating in MO3's murder.
Legal Perspectives and Trial Outlook
- ⏳ Defense attorneys often request bond modifications for parental involvement, but judges may deny them due to the severity of charges and flight risk.
- 📈 The prosecution's case hinges on establishing a causal connection between Yella Beezy and Kewon White, potentially through communication records or testimony.
- 🗓️ While Yella Beezy has a right to a speedy trial, the exact timing remains uncertain, with a hearing scheduled for May 5th and no trial date yet set.
